Transaction 42e72439926f857e9eaa61a5bc4b7e1c92032f520bf90199c25767006cd249a2
1 Input
1 Output
-
42e72439926f857e9eaa61a5bc4b7e1c92032f520bf90199c25767006cd249a2:0
- value
- 955514
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9010814373730827ad6001c24898a500b0ef81b0 OP_EQUAL
- address
- 3Epkzx5FMV71uzdsRtrXzhs1Cxr7Y7YKrw